@import "https://fonts.googleapis.com/css2?family=Inter:wght@300;400;500;600;700&family=Montserrat:wght@600;700;800;900&display=swap";
:root{--red-dark:#aa1b1e;--red-vivid:#d41820;--red-glow:#d418202e;--white:#fff;--black:#0a0a0a;--gray-900:#111;--gray-800:#1a1a1a;--gray-700:#2a2a2a;--gray-300:#aaa;--gray-100:#f5f5f5;--heading-font:"Montserrat",sans-serif;--body-font:"Inter",sans-serif;--radius-sm:6px;--radius-md:12px;--radius-lg:20px;--shadow-red:0 4px 32px #d418204d;--shadow-card:0 2px 24px #00000047;--transition:.25s cubic-bezier(.4,0,.2,1)}*,:before,:after{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}body{font-family:var(--body-font);background:var(--black);color:var(--white);-webkit-font-smoothing:antialiased;line-height:1.65}img{max-width:100%;display:block}a{color:inherit;text-decoration:none}ul{list-style:none}h1,h2,h3,h4,h5{font-family:var(--heading-font);letter-spacing:-.02em;font-weight:800;line-height:1.15}h1{font-size:clamp(2.2rem,5vw,4rem)}h2{font-size:clamp(1.8rem,3.5vw,2.8rem)}h3{font-size:clamp(1.2rem,2vw,1.6rem)}p{color:var(--gray-300);font-size:1.05rem;line-height:1.75}.container{max-width:1160px;margin:0 auto;padding:0 1.5rem}.section{padding:6rem 0}.section-sm{padding:3.5rem 0}.text-center{text-align:center}.gradient-text{background:linear-gradient(90deg,var(--red-vivid),#ff6b6b);-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text}.btn{border-radius:var(--radius-sm);font-family:var(--heading-font);letter-spacing:.03em;cursor:pointer;transition:all var(--transition);border:2px solid #0000;align-items:center;gap:.5rem;padding:.85rem 2rem;font-size:.95rem;font-weight:700;display:inline-flex}.btn-primary{background:var(--red-vivid);color:var(--white);box-shadow:var(--shadow-red)}.btn-primary:hover{background:var(--red-dark);transform:translateY(-2px);box-shadow:0 8px 40px #d4182073}.btn-outline{color:var(--white);background:0 0;border-color:#ffffff4d}.btn-outline:hover{border-color:var(--red-vivid);color:var(--red-vivid);transform:translateY(-2px)}.card{background:var(--gray-800);border:1px solid var(--gray-700);border-radius:var(--radius-md);transition:all var(--transition);padding:2rem}.card:hover{border-color:var(--red-vivid);box-shadow:var(--shadow-red);transform:translateY(-4px)}.section-label{background:var(--red-glow);color:var(--red-vivid);letter-spacing:.1em;text-transform:uppercase;border:1px solid #d4182066;border-radius:999px;margin-bottom:1rem;padding:.3rem 1rem;font-size:.78rem;font-weight:700;display:inline-block}.divider{background:linear-gradient(90deg,transparent,var(--gray-700),transparent);height:1px;margin:0}.grid-2{grid-template-columns:repeat(2,1fr);gap:2rem;display:grid}.grid-3{grid-template-columns:repeat(3,1fr);gap:2rem;display:grid}.grid-4{grid-template-columns:repeat(4,1fr);gap:1.5rem;display:grid}@media (max-width:900px){.grid-3,.grid-4{grid-template-columns:repeat(2,1fr)}}@media (max-width:600px){.grid-2,.grid-3,.grid-4{grid-template-columns:1fr}}.badge{background:var(--gray-700);border-radius:999px;align-items:center;gap:.4rem;padding:.3rem .85rem;font-size:.82rem;font-weight:600;display:inline-flex}.stat-number{font-family:var(--heading-font);color:var(--red-vivid);font-size:clamp(2rem,4vw,3.2rem);font-weight:900;line-height:1}
.Navbar-module__cJzEcG__header{z-index:100;padding:1.2rem 0;transition:all .3s;position:fixed;top:0;left:0;right:0}.Navbar-module__cJzEcG__scrolled{-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);background:#0a0a0af2;border-bottom:1px solid #ffffff0f;padding:.8rem 0}.Navbar-module__cJzEcG__inner{justify-content:space-between;align-items:center;display:flex}.Navbar-module__cJzEcG__logo{align-items:center;display:flex}.Navbar-module__cJzEcG__logoImage{width:auto;height:32px;display:block}.Navbar-module__cJzEcG__nav{align-items:center;gap:2rem;display:flex}.Navbar-module__cJzEcG__navLink{color:#aaa;font-size:.9rem;font-weight:500;transition:color .2s}.Navbar-module__cJzEcG__navLink:hover{color:#fff}.Navbar-module__cJzEcG__hamburger{cursor:pointer;background:0 0;border:none;flex-direction:column;gap:5px;padding:4px;display:none}.Navbar-module__cJzEcG__hamburger span{background:#fff;border-radius:2px;width:24px;height:2px;transition:all .3s;display:block}.Navbar-module__cJzEcG__mobileMenu{background:#111;border-top:1px solid #222;flex-direction:column;gap:1rem;padding:1.5rem;display:flex}.Navbar-module__cJzEcG__mobileLink{color:#ccc;border-bottom:1px solid #1f1f1f;padding:.5rem 0;font-size:1rem;font-weight:500}@media (max-width:768px){.Navbar-module__cJzEcG__nav{display:none}.Navbar-module__cJzEcG__hamburger{display:flex}}
.Footer-module__S6Hkya__footer{background:#0a0a0a;border-top:1px solid #1f1f1f;padding:4rem 0 0}.Footer-module__S6Hkya__inner{grid-template-columns:2fr 1fr 1fr;gap:3rem;padding-bottom:3rem;display:grid}.Footer-module__S6Hkya__brand p{color:#888;max-width:280px;margin-top:.75rem;font-size:.92rem;line-height:1.6}.Footer-module__S6Hkya__footerLogo{margin-bottom:.5rem;display:inline-block}.Footer-module__S6Hkya__logoImage{width:auto;height:48px;display:block}.Footer-module__S6Hkya__socials{gap:.75rem;margin-top:1.25rem;display:flex}.Footer-module__S6Hkya__socialIcon{color:#aaa;background:#1a1a1a;border-radius:50%;justify-content:center;align-items:center;width:38px;height:38px;transition:all .25s;display:flex}.Footer-module__S6Hkya__socialIcon:hover{color:#fff;background:#d41820}.Footer-module__S6Hkya__links h4{text-transform:uppercase;letter-spacing:.1em;color:#ccc;margin-bottom:1rem;font-family:Montserrat,sans-serif;font-size:.85rem;font-weight:700}.Footer-module__S6Hkya__links ul{flex-direction:column;gap:.65rem;display:flex}.Footer-module__S6Hkya__links ul li a{color:#777;font-size:.9rem;transition:color .2s}.Footer-module__S6Hkya__links ul li a:hover{color:#d41820}.Footer-module__S6Hkya__bottom{color:#555;border-top:1px solid #1a1a1a;justify-content:space-between;align-items:center;padding:1.25rem 2rem;font-size:.82rem;display:flex}.Footer-module__S6Hkya__bottom a{color:#555;transition:color .2s}.Footer-module__S6Hkya__bottom a:hover{color:#d41820}@media (max-width:768px){.Footer-module__S6Hkya__inner{grid-template-columns:1fr 1fr}.Footer-module__S6Hkya__brand{grid-column:1/-1}}@media (max-width:480px){.Footer-module__S6Hkya__inner{grid-template-columns:1fr}.Footer-module__S6Hkya__bottom{text-align:center;flex-direction:column;gap:.5rem}}
.WhatsAppButton-module__V-0EQa__button{z-index:999;color:#fff;background:#25d366;border-radius:50%;justify-content:center;align-items:center;width:58px;height:58px;transition:transform .25s,box-shadow .25s;display:flex;position:fixed;bottom:2rem;right:2rem;box-shadow:0 4px 20px #25d36673}.WhatsAppButton-module__V-0EQa__button:hover{transform:scale(1.1);box-shadow:0 8px 32px #25d36699}.WhatsAppButton-module__V-0EQa__pulse{background:#25d36666;border-radius:50%;width:58px;height:58px;animation:2s infinite WhatsAppButton-module__V-0EQa__pulse;position:absolute}@keyframes WhatsAppButton-module__V-0EQa__pulse{0%{opacity:.8;transform:scale(1)}70%{opacity:0;transform:scale(1.5)}to{opacity:0;transform:scale(1.5)}}
